The Biggest Pros and Cons
The 1988 Sea Ray 345 Sedan offers a blend of classic styling and practical features that appeal to many boating enthusiasts. Here are some of the pros and cons of this model:
Pros
Spacious Interior: The 345 Sedan boasts a roomy cabin with comfortable seating and sleeping accommodations, making it ideal for weekend getaways.
Versatile Layout: Its sedan-style design provides an enclosed helm area with good visibility and protection from the elements, enhancing comfort during cruising.
Quality Build: Known for solid construction, the Sea Ray 345 Sedan features durable materials and reliable systems typical of Sea Ray craftsmanship in the late 1980s.
Good Performance: Equipped with twin engines, it offers decent power and handling suitable for coastal cruising and lake use.
Ample Storage: The boat includes plenty of storage compartments, helping keep the cabin organized and clutter-free.
Cons
Aging Systems: As a vessel from 1988, some mechanical and electrical components may require updating or replacement to meet modern standards.
Fuel Efficiency: The twin-engine setup, while powerful, can be less fuel-efficient compared to more modern designs and engine technology.
Limited Headroom: Although spacious, the cabin headroom may feel a bit confined for taller individuals.
Maintenance Needs: Older boats generally demand more regular maintenance and care to remain in optimal condition.
Outdated Electronics: Original navigation and entertainment systems are likely outdated, necessitating upgrades for improved functionality.
